- Liposome-aptamer complex for removing endocrine disrupting chemicals and method for removing endocrine disrupting chemicals by using the same

摘要

A liposome-aptamer complex is provided to remove endocrine disrupting chemicals effectively by positioning the hexane aptamer in a submicron-sized liposome consisted of a bilayer lipid membrane so that a hexane aptamer peculiarly bonded to endocrine disrupting chemicals can be used in an actual underwater environment, thereby bonding well the hexane aptamer to the endocrine disrupting chemicals, and a method for removing endocrine disrupting chemicals in an underwater environment by using the liposome-aptamer complex is provided. A liposome-aptamer complex for removing endocrine disrupting chemicals is characterized in that a hexane aptamer peculiarly bondable with endocrine disrupting chemicals is introduced into a liposome consisted of a bilayer lipid membrane. A preparation method of a liposome-aptamer complex for removing endocrine disrupting chemicals comprises the steps of: developing an aptamer perculiar to target endocrine disrupting chemicals by an SELEX(Systematic Evolution of Ligands by Exponential enrichment) method; dissolving a single lipid material into chloroform, evaporating the dissolved solution to form a dilayer lipid membrane, injecting a buffer capable of being bonded optimally to the endocrine disrupting chemicals into the dilayer lipid membrane, and forming a liposome from the mixture using a sonicator; mixing the aptamer and the liposome in a tris bubber; mixing an ethanol/calcium chloride solution with the mixed solution, and dialyzing the mixed solution with a PBS solution; and purifying a liposome-aptamer comple using a high speed centrifuge.
